NewsNews releasePublic service announcement Apply Reset Search Sort: Sort Old-NewNew-OldA-ZZ-A Showing 11 Article(s) May 26 2023 Vancouver Coastal Health and Teck Partner to Study How Bacteria-killing Copper Can Reduce the Risk of Infection Transmission in Long-term Care Homes Vancouver Coastal Health (VCH), Teck Resources Limited and VGH & UBC Hospital Foundation are partnering to study how antimicrobial copper can be used to prevent infections and improve health outcomes in three long-term care homes across the VCH region. Funded by Teck, it will be the first study of its size in Canada.
